What You’ll Need
To create these delicious Frozen Pumpkin Peanut Butter Dog Treats, gather the following ingredients:
- 1 cup pumpkin puree
- 1/2 cup peanut butter
- 1/2 cup water
- 1 tablespoon honey (optional)
- Silicone molds or ice cube trays

Directions to Follow
- In a mixing bowl, combine the pumpkin puree, peanut butter, water, and honey until the mixture is smooth.
- Pour the mixture into silicone molds or ice cube trays.
- Freeze for several hours or until solid.
- Remove from the molds and serve to your pup as a refreshing treat.

Keeping Leftovers Fresh
To maintain the quality of your treats, it’s best to store them in an airtight container in the freezer. This way, they will remain fresh for future doggie snacks. Keep in mind that if left out at room temperature, they may melt quickly.
Tips for Success
- For added flavor, consider including a tablespoon of unsweetened yogurt into the mixture, which dogs also love.
- If you don’t have silicone molds, any ice cube tray will work just fine.
- Experiment with other flavors by adding mashed bananas or sweet potatoes for variety.

FAQs
Can I use fresh pumpkin instead of canned?
Yes, you can use fresh pumpkin, but ensure it’s cooked and pureed for best results.
Are these treats suitable for dogs with allergies?
If your dog is allergic to peanut butter, consider substituting it with sunflower seed butter or another safe alternative.
How long do these treats last?
When stored properly in the freezer, the treats can last up to three months.
